Gender Equality and Social Inclusion (GESI) Coordinator

  • Reports to Executive Director Works closely with Key Advisor Gender Equality and Social Inclusion No line management responsibility
  • Responsible for ensuring that GESI is mainstreamed across all programme activities and working closely with the GESI Key Adviser to oversee the following activities and tasks:
  • Support NCTE to work with universities and Colleges of Education to monitor progress against the National Teacher Education GESI Strategy 2020-25; Ensure that GESI is adequately incorporated in both the new SHS teacher education curriculum framework and within the Key Phase 5 curriculum in schools: Mainstream GESI within SHS through the
  • “Leadership for Learning component where every SHS will need to develop a GESI Strategy and Action Plan for their own institution.
  • Tackling issues of sexual harassment will be a priority activity within all GESI Action Plans. Expire with GES the possibility of developing a National Senior High School GESI Strategy which can then form the basis for the development of individual SHS action plans.

QUALIFICATION

  • Postgraduate qualification or equivalent in education, gender, development, or a relevant discipline.
  • A minimum of 5 years working experience in education project management, capacity building workshops organization and facilitation is required Demonstrate a passion for, and understanding of the value of education and a commitment to gender equality and social inclusion
  • Knowledge and experience of the interaction between GESI issues and the education sector in Ghana, preferably including the teacher education and secondary education sub-sectors and with knowledge and understanding of inclusive education.
  • Track record of delivering improved GESI outcomes in the education sector
  • Ability to manage relationships with multiple stakeholders.
  • Strong interpersonal and communication skills Experience in monitoring the implementation of work plans, performance, and results.
  • Well-organized, task- and time-oriented, and with close attention to details.
  • Good ICT and report writing skills including experience in preparing donor reports.
  • Independent with the ability to use own initiative and ability to be flexible
